    i agree with you, im a graduate from Crengland but i wish i never did...everything was a joke and the training is tough but and it was risky at the same time because how the hell im a newbie in training you got me driving a big truck from dallas texas conway terminal to phoenix, arizona and my trainer was spleeping all day long and it was my second day in training. Don't go there and don't rush anything take your time do more research and hopefully you will come up with something better than crengland.

    I wouldn't recommend it, unless England has a dedicated route you want, they will take people right off thier phase 2 and put them on dedicated.

    Related to that i have shown like 10 drivers how to slide tandems, how can they complete phase 1 and 2 and still not know? If anything that is amazingly substandard training.

    I work on the dedicated side, it isnt great but, at least i don't even carry chains or go to Slc, Burns Harbor, etc. And i do love my new Pete with the single bed, but yoi won't get that in the OTR division. There are much better training companies
